Ferrum College Psychology Students Hold Book Fair to Promote Literacy January 25- 27

   The Ferrum College Psychology Club is holding a book fair at Barnes & Noble at Tanglewood Mall from Friday January 25th through Sunday January 27th to promote literacy and raise money for Ferrum Elementary School and the Psychology Club. Special events are planned at the store on Saturday, January 26th from 9 a.m. to 6 p.m. and on Sunday, January 27th from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. These will include children’s crafts, coffee samplings, story times, and book signings to name a few.

   During the entire three-days of the book fair, a percentage of purchases (including café items) made with a voucher at Barnes & Noble will benefit the elementary school and the club. Customers can also use the number on the voucher and buy books from Barnes & Noble on the Internet on those dates. “Wish lists” of books that Ferrum Elementary School needs will be available and customers can buy these books and donate the books to the school.

   Sharon Stein, Associate Professor of Psychology at Ferrum College, says, “The Psychology Club has always been actively involved in service to others by participating in a variety of community projects. We also felt the book fair fits well with the college’s theme this year of “Social and Economic Justice” and the profession of psychology. We know how important it is for children to play – this is how they deal and adjust. Our goal in this current project is to promote the love of books in children by encouraging them to come to a bookstore, have fun with crafts and story time, and maybe pick out a book they’ll enjoy.”

   Vouchers and other information are being sent home with Ferrum Elementary students and additional vouchers will be available at the Tanglewood Barnes & Noble store. For more information on the upcoming bookfair, contact Sharon Stein at 365-4393 or sstein@ferrum.edu
